Brickman, as the fluid warms, the whining does go down in volume a bit. Also, downshifting to a lower range reduces whining. The harder the HST works, the more it whines. Some have reported that using synthetic hydraulic fluids reduces whine. I don't know, but I do know that New Holland Multi-G 134 fluid produces less whine than some substitutes I've tried (like TSC's brand). I live in Texas and don't use my tractor on a regular basis in cold weather, so I may not be the best reference for whine reduction. I can tell you that synthetic fluid is very expensive, so you have to decide if getting rid of some whine is worth the extra cost.:)
